logo
RunComfy
  • ComfyUI
  • TrainerNuovo
  • Modelli
  • API
  • Prezzi
discord logo
MODELLI
Esplora
Tutti i modelli
LIBRERIA
Generazioni
API DEI MODELLI
Documentazione API
Chiavi API
ACCOUNT
Utilizzo

Seedance 1.5 Pro: Generazione Video Cinematografica con Audio Integrato e Sincronizzazione Labiale | RunComfy

bytedance/seedance-v1.5-pro/image-to-video

Seedance 1.5 Pro genera video cinematografici multilingue da testo o immagini con dialoghi sincronizzati, controllo della camera e narrazione audiovisiva fluida per pubblicità, doppiaggio e produzioni creative di cortometraggi.

Indice

1. Per iniziare2. Autenticazione3. Riferimento APIInvia una richiestaStato della richiestaRecupera i risultatiAnnulla richiesta4. File in ingressoFile ospitato (URL)5. SchemaSchema di inputSchema di output

1. Per iniziare

Usa l'API RunComfy per eseguire bytedance/seedance-v1.5-pro/image-to-video. Per input e output accettati, consulta lo schema.

curl --request POST \
  --url https://model-api.runcomfy.net/v1/models/bytedance/seedance-v1.5-pro/image-to-video \
  --header "Content-Type: application/json" \
  --header "Authorization: Bearer <token>" \
  --data '{
    "prompt": "A gentle breeze blows softly, and the real girl's body remains stable. Her long hair, including the hair below, flutters naturally. The anime girl on the phone screen first closes her eyes for 2 seconds, then slowly opens them, with her mouth remaining still and silent. Her hair, including the hair below, also flutters naturally in the breeze in perfect synchronization. The rhythm and direction of the hair fluttering of the two girls are exactly the same.  The subway train moves rapidly, emitting a low rumbling echo. ",
    "first_frame_image_url": "https://playgrounds-storage-public.runcomfy.net/tools/7272/media-files/input-1-1.png"
  }'

2. Autenticazione

Imposta la variabile d'ambiente YOUR_API_TOKEN con la tua chiave API (gestione nel Profilo) e includi in ogni richiesta un token Bearer nell'intestazione Authorization : Authorization: Bearer $YOUR_API_TOKEN.

3. Riferimento API

Invia una richiesta

Invia un job di generazione asincrono e ricevi subito un request_id e URL per stato, risultati e annullamento.

curl --request POST \
  --url https://model-api.runcomfy.net/v1/models/bytedance/seedance-v1.5-pro/image-to-video \
  --header "Content-Type: application/json" \
  --header "Authorization: Bearer <token>" \
  --data '{
    "prompt": "A gentle breeze blows softly, and the real girl's body remains stable. Her long hair, including the hair below, flutters naturally. The anime girl on the phone screen first closes her eyes for 2 seconds, then slowly opens them, with her mouth remaining still and silent. Her hair, including the hair below, also flutters naturally in the breeze in perfect synchronization. The rhythm and direction of the hair fluttering of the two girls are exactly the same.  The subway train moves rapidly, emitting a low rumbling echo. ",
    "first_frame_image_url": "https://playgrounds-storage-public.runcomfy.net/tools/7272/media-files/input-1-1.png"
  }'

Stato della richiesta

Recupera lo stato corrente per un request_id ("in_queue", "in_progress", "completed" o "cancelled").

curl --request GET \
  --url https://model-api.runcomfy.net/v1/requests/{request_id}/status \
  --header "Authorization: Bearer <token>"

Recupera i risultati

Recupera output finali e metadati per il request_id; se il job non è completo, la risposta restituisce lo stato corrente per continuare il polling.

curl --request GET \
  --url https://model-api.runcomfy.net/v1/requests/{request_id}/result \
  --header "Authorization: Bearer <token>"

Annulla richiesta

Annulla un job in coda tramite request_id; i job in corso non possono essere annullati.

curl --request POST \
  --url https://model-api.runcomfy.net/v1/requests/{request_id}/cancel \
  --header "Authorization: Bearer <token>"

4. File in ingresso

File ospitato (URL)

Fornisci un URL HTTPS raggiungibile pubblicamente. L'host deve consentire fetch lato server (senza login/cookie), senza rate limit eccessivo o blocco bot. Consigliato: immagini ≤ 50 MB (~4K), video ≤ 100 MB (~2–5 min a 720p). Per asset privati, URL stabili o pre-firmati.

5. Schema

Schema di input

{
  "type": "object",
  "title": "Schema di input",
  "required": [
    "prompt",
    "first_frame_image_url"
  ],
  "properties": {
    "prompt": {
      "title": "Prompt",
      "description": "Il prompt deve contenere meno di 500 caratteri per ottenere risultati migliori.",
      "type": "string",
      "default": "A gentle breeze blows softly, and the real girl's body remains stable. Her long hair, including the hair below, flutters naturally. The anime girl on the phone screen first closes her eyes for 2 seconds, then slowly opens them, with her mouth remaining still and silent. Her hair, including the hair below, also flutters naturally in the breeze in perfect synchronization. The rhythm and direction of the hair fluttering of the two girls are exactly the same.  The subway train moves rapidly, emitting a low rumbling echo. "
    },
    "first_frame_image_url": {
      "title": "Immagine di partenza",
      "description": "",
      "type": "string",
      "validations": [
        {
          "validation_rule": "width_pixels<",
          "validation_value": 6000,
          "validation_error": "La larghezza e l'altezza dell'immagine non devono superare 6000 pixel."
        },
        {
          "validation_rule": "height_pixels<",
          "validation_value": 6000,
          "validation_error": "La larghezza e l'altezza dell'immagine non devono superare 6000 pixel."
        },
        {
          "validation_rule": "width_pixels>",
          "validation_value": 300,
          "validation_error": "La larghezza e l'altezza dell'immagine non devono essere inferiori a 300 pixel."
        },
        {
          "validation_rule": "height_pixels>",
          "validation_value": 300,
          "validation_error": "La larghezza e l'altezza dell'immagine non devono essere inferiori a 300 pixel."
        },
        {
          "validation_rule": "width/height>",
          "validation_value": 0.4,
          "validation_error": "Il rapporto d'aspetto deve essere compreso tra 0,4 e 2,5."
        },
        {
          "validation_rule": "width/height<",
          "validation_value": 2.5,
          "validation_error": "Il rapporto d'aspetto deve essere compreso tra 0,4 e 2,5."
        },
        {
          "validation_rule": "file_size_mb<",
          "validation_value": 30,
          "validation_error": "La dimensione del file deve essere inferiore a 30 MB."
        }
      ],
      "default": "https://playgrounds-storage-public.runcomfy.net/tools/7272/media-files/input-1-1.png"
    },
    "resolution": {
      "title": "Risoluzione",
      "description": "",
      "type": "string",
      "enum": [
        "480p",
        "720p",
        "1080p"
      ],
      "default": "480p"
    },
    "ratio": {
      "title": "Rapporto d'aspetto (L:A)",
      "description": "",
      "type": "string",
      "enum": [
        "16:9",
        "4:3",
        "1:1",
        "3:4",
        "9:16",
        "21:9",
        "adaptive"
      ],
      "default": "adaptive"
    },
    "duration": {
      "title": "Durata",
      "description": "",
      "type": "integer",
      "enum": [
        4,
        5,
        6,
        7,
        8,
        9,
        10,
        11,
        12
      ],
      "default": 5
    },
    "generate_audio": {
      "title": "Genera audio",
      "description": "",
      "type": "boolean",
      "default": true
    },
    "camera_fixed": {
      "title": "Camera fissa",
      "description": "Definisce se la camera rimane fissa nel video.",
      "type": "boolean",
      "default": true
    }
  }
}

Schema di output

{
  "output": {
    "type": "object",
    "properties": {
      "image": {
        "type": "string",
        "format": "uri",
        "description": "URL immagine singola"
      },
      "video": {
        "type": "string",
        "format": "uri",
        "description": "URL video singolo"
      },
      "images": {
        "type": "array",
        "description": "più URL immagine",
        "items": {
          "type": "string",
          "format": "uri"
        }
      },
      "videos": {
        "type": "array",
        "description": "più URL video",
        "items": {
          "type": "string",
          "format": "uri"
        }
      }
    }
  }
}
Seguici
  • LinkedIn
  • Facebook
  • Instagram
  • Twitter
Supporto
  • Discord
  • Email
  • Stato del Sistema
  • affiliato
Modelli Video
  • Wan 2.6 Flash
  • Kling Video O3 Pro Image To Video
  • Wan 2.6
  • Seedance 2.0 Fast
  • Hailuo 2.3 Fast Standard
  • Kling 3.0
  • Visualizza tutti i modelli →
Modelli Immagine
  • seedream 4.0
  • Nano Banana 2 Edit
  • Flux 2 Dev
  • Nano Banana Pro
  • GPT Image 2 Image Edit
  • FLUX.1 Schnell
  • Visualizza tutti i modelli →
Legale
  • Termini di Servizio
  • Informativa sulla Privacy
  • Informativa sui Cookie
RunComfy
Copyright 2026 RunComfy. Tutti i Diritti Riservati.

RunComfy è la piattaforma principale ComfyUI che offre ComfyUI online ambiente e servizi, insieme a workflow di ComfyUI con visuali mozzafiato. RunComfy offre anche AI Models, consentire agli artisti di sfruttare gli ultimi strumenti di AI per creare arte incredibile.